What is Stott & Harrington?
Founded by Joseph E. Stott and Freddie N. Harrington, Stott & Harrington, P.C. operates as a full-service civil litigation practice. With a legacy spanning over four decades of combined legal expertise, the firm provides comprehensive representation for both individual and corporate clients. Their market position is defined by deep-rooted regional knowledge and a commitment to navigating complex litigation landscapes in Alabama. How much funding has Stott & Harrington raised?
Stott & Harrington has raised a total of $81K across 1 funding round:
Debt
$81K
Debt (2021): $81K with participation from PPP
